秀人网从零开始:播放器进阶设置与个性化配置技巧(2025 深度版)

秀人网从零开始:播放器进阶设置与个性化配置技巧(2025 深度版)

秀人网从零开始:播放器进阶设置与个性化配置技巧(2025 深度版)

引言 如果你经常在网站上浏览高质量图片与视频组合的内容,一个稳定、流畅、可个性化的播放器体验就像一对隐形的助力臂,能让你更专注于内容本身,而不是为加载卡顿、画质波动或操作不顺而分心。本指南面向从零基础到进阶的用户,系统梳理播放器的核心参数、可自定义的界面与交互、以及在2025年的新特性中,如何实现更高效的观感与控制。无论你是在桌面端还是移动端,掌握这些技巧都能显著提升观看体验与页面停留时长。

一、从零起步:理解播放器的核心要素

秀人网从零开始:播放器进阶设置与个性化配置技巧(2025 深度版)

  • 你要解决的三大问题 1) 画质与流畅度的权衡:在带宽有限时,如何保持可接受的清晰度和连贯性。 2) 交互的友好性:快捷键、控件自定义、字幕与音轨切换等,提升可控性。 3) 个性化体验:主题、字幕样式、默认播放行为等,让播放器更符合你的使用习惯。
  • 选择合适的技术栈
  • HTML5 Video + 自定义控制栏的组合,是最普遍、最兼容的方案。
  • 自适应流媒体(HLS/DASH)适用于不同网络条件,提升低带宽环境下的观看稳定性。
  • UI 框架与插件:Video.js、Plyr、Shaka Player 等可以在不牺牲性能的前提下快速实现美观且可定制的界面。
  • 了解服务器端对播放器的影响
  • 如果你掌控资源服务器,确保多码率的清单(Manifest)覆盖常见分辨率和码率,便于 ABR(自适应比特率)策略做出快速切换。
  • 字幕与音轨的打包方式、以及是否支持外部字幕/音轨的切换,直接影响用户体验。

二、进阶设置的逻辑框架

  • 确定目标场景
  • 高质量沉浸式观感:偏向高码率、较长缓冲起步时间的设置。
  • 移动优先、低数据消耗:倾向于更严格的码率上限、较短的初始缓冲。
  • 学习/对比场景:强调精确的时间跳转、字幕对齐与多音轨切换的稳定性。
  • 先设定基线,再逐项微调
  • 基线通常包含:初始缓冲时长、自动播放/自动暂停策略、默认分辨率、字幕字号与颜色、默认音轨。
  • 在此基础上,针对网络条件、设备性能、用户偏好逐步调整。

三、可操作的高级配置清单 1) 自适应流与品质策略

  • 使用 HLS/DASH 的多码率清单,确保覆盖常见分辨率(例如 360p、480p、720p、1080p、4K,根据实际资源调整)。
  • ABR 策略要点:
  • 启用自适应切换,优先在网络波动时保持无卡顿的平滑切换。
  • 设置合理的最大分辨率上限,避免在极端带宽条件下瞬间跳升导致缓冲增加。
  • 对高并发页面,尽量让初始分辨率较低,快速进入播放后再逐步提升。 2) 缓冲与加载策略
  • 初始缓冲时长(initialBufferMs):在移动网络上选择较低的起步缓冲,桌面或WiFi环境可适当增大。
  • 最大缓冲区长度(maxBufferMs):避免长时间全缓冲导致资源占用过高,兼顾流畅度与内存占用。
  • 预加载策略(preload):idle 时的预加载可以提升启动速度,但要考虑移动数据和后台资源。 3) 硬件加速与解码
  • 启用硬件解码与加速(Hardware Acceleration):在支持的设备上能显著提升解码效率、降低功耗。
  • 对比不同浏览器对 WebCodecs/WebGL/WebGPU 的支持情况,选择兼容性最佳的实现路径。 4) 字幕与音轨
  • 字幕样式:字号、颜色、阴影、背景透明度、边缘清晰度。确保对比度合适、在不同背景下可读。
  • 字幕加载策略:外部字幕优先级,若有多语言,提供稳定的切换入口。
  • 音轨切换:快速切换不同语言/声道,尽量让切换过程不引发剧烈缓冲。 5) 用户界面与交互
  • 自定义控件:最常用的播放/暂停、音量、全屏、进度条、字幕开关等按钮的位置和大小,优先考虑触控友好。
  • 快捷键设置:空格/空格暂停、左/右箭头前进后退、M 静音、F 全屏、C/Ctrl+C 字幕开关等,确保键位不冲突且易记。
  • 主题与风格:深色/浅色主题、控件透明度、圆角、阴影等,提升与站点整体风格的一致性。 6) 预设与模板
  • 通过预设实现“一键切换”体验:如“低带宽模式”、“沉浸式模式”、“字幕聚焦模式”等,方便不同场景快速切换。
  • 保存与分享自定义设置:允许用户导出/导入自己的配置,提升复用性。 7) 监控与分析
  • 集成基本的观影指标:启动时间、首帧加载时长、缓冲事件频率、平均码率、跳帧次数等,用于后续优化。
  • 定期回顾数据,针对波动点(如某些页签或设备上)做针对性调整。

四、在页面层面的实现要点

  • 选择合适的播放器实现方式
  • 使用成熟的 UI 框架(如 Video.js、Plyr)可以快速实现一致的控件风格、事件机制和插件扩展。
  • 自定义控件时,确保事件传递清晰,避免对原生浏览器行为的干扰。
  • 兼容性与回退策略
  • 保留原生控件的回退路径,在不支持自定义控件的浏览器上仍能稳定播放。
  • 对比不同浏览器的特性差异,避免某些控件在特定版本上不可用的情况。
  • 可访问性
  • 提供屏幕阅读器友好的标签、清晰的对比度、可聚焦的控件顺序。
  • 字幕可选的同时提供文字描述版本,确保信息的完整性。
  • 性能优化
  • 懒加载控件与异步初始化,减少页面初始渲染时间。
  • 使用合适的媒体缓存策略、避免不必要的资源重复加载。
  • 安全与隐私
  • 避免不必要的跨域请求,确保播放器脚本来源可信。
  • 对于统计与日志,采用最小化数据收集原则,明确告知用户数据使用方式。
  • 测试与验证
  • 针对不同网络状况、不同设备、不同浏览器进行多轮测试,确保断点切换、字幕加载、音轨切换等功能稳定。

五、2025年的新特性与趋势

  • WebCodecs 与 WebGPU 的兴起
  • WebCodecs 能直接访问浏览器提供的解码能力,可能带来更低延迟的解码路径,提升高分辨率视频的响应速度与稳定性。
  • WebGPU 的引入有望在高质量渲染、过渡效果与自定义控件动画方面提供更高性能的实现。
  • 低延迟直播与交互式体验
  • 更成熟的低延迟 HLS/DASH 实现,使实时或接近实时的互动场景成为可能。
  • 可访问性与个性化结合
  • 越来越多的站点在个性化设置中加入无障碍选项,确保多样化的观看需求都能得到良好支持。

六、实用案例:从设定到落地的一组操作步骤 场景A:桌面端高质量观看体验

  • 步骤1:选择 Video.js + hls.js 的组合,开启自适应码率。
  • 步骤2:设定初始缓冲为 1.5 秒,最大缓冲不超过 30 秒,确保启动迅速。
  • 步骤3:默认分辨率设为 720p,必要时自动提升到 1080p。
  • 步骤4:字幕字号 18px,颜色白色、阴影适度,确保对比度。
  • 步骤5:全屏、音量、进度条等控件位置按常用布局放置,快捷键启用。 场景B:移动端低带宽优先
  • 步骤1:启用低带宽模式,初始缓冲设短、最大码率受限。
  • 步骤2:自动降级到较低分辨率,避免频繁缓冲。
  • 步骤3:字幕与音轨切换保留,界面尽量简洁,节省屏幕空间。 场景C:沉浸式观感与无干扰模式
  • 步骤1:开启无干扰模式,隐藏默认控件,仅保留播放/暂停与字幕开关。
  • 步骤2:默认背景色与控件风格统一,确保视觉连贯性。
  • 步骤3:启用预设,一键切换到沉浸式模板。

七、实操清单(快速回顾)

  • 明确目标场景:高画质、低带宽、沉浸式等。
  • 选择稳定的技术栈与插件组合。
  • 配置自适应流与缓冲策略,确保启动与切换的平滑。
  • 设置字幕、音轨与快捷键,提升可控性。
  • 提供多种预设模板,方便不同场景切换。
  • 监控关键性能指标,持续迭代优化。
  • 考虑无障碍与隐私保护,提升可访问性与信任度。
  • 跟进 2025 年的新特性,保持前沿性与兼容性。

八、结语 掌握从零到进阶的播放器设置,既是对技术的一次深耕,也是对用户体验的一次用心优化。通过理解核心要素、落地可执行的设置、以及对新特性的前瞻性应用,你可以在任何内容平台上实现更稳定、更个性化的观看体验。希望这份深度指南能成为你打造优质观看环境的实用手册。

作者简介(可选) 本篇文章作者是一名专注于数字内容传播与自我品牌建设的写作者,拥有多年自媒体与网站运营经验,擅长把复杂的技术要点拆解成易于执行的步骤,同时兼具直观的使用场景与实用的优化建议。如果你想了解更多关于内容创作、产品推广与个人品牌提升的高质量指南,欢迎关注后续更新。

若你愿意,我也可以根据你的站点风格、目标读者群体与具体技术栈,进一步定制一版更贴合你页面设计的版本,确保发布时的排版、关键词与结构最契合你的 Google 网站。